RealPage Reports Q3 2012 Financial Results


CARROLLTON, Texas --(Business Wire)--

RealPage, Inc. (NASDAQ:RP), a leading provider of on-demand software and software-enabled services to the rental housing industry, today announced financial results for its third quarter ended September 30, 2012.

"Third quarter financial results were solid," said Steve Winn, Chairman and CEO of RealPage. "Our core business metrics of organic on demand revenue, Adjusted EBITDA and annual customer value continue to grow in line with our long-term operating model. All product families reported growth with aggregate on demand revenue up over 25% for the quarter."

Third Quarter 2012 Financial Highlights

  • Non-GAAP total revenue was $83.2 million, an increase of 22.5% year-over-year;
  • Non-GAAP on demand revenue was $79.0 million, an increase of 25.3% year-over-year;
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$18.8 million, an increase of 25.0% year-over-year;
  • Non-GAAP net income was $8.9 million, or $0.12 per diluted share, a year-over-year increase of 27.5% and 20.0%, respectively;
  • GAAP net income was $2.1 million, or $0.03 per diluted share, compared to a GAAP net loss of $1.1 million, or $0.02 per diluted share, in the prior year quarter; and
  • Excluding the cash impact from Yardi related litigation, net cash provided by operating activities was $16.4 million, an increase of 45.4% year-over-year.

Financial Outlook

RealPage management expects to achieve the following results during its fourth quarter ended December 31, 2012:

  • Non-GAAP total revenue is expected to be in the range of $85.5 million to $87.5 million;
  • Adjusted EBITDA is expected to be in the range of $20.0 million to $21.5 million;
  • Non-GAAP net income is expected to be in the range of $9.7 million to $10.5 million, or $0.13 to $0.14 per diluted share;
  • Non-GAAP tax rate of approximately 40.0%; and
  • Weighted average shares outstanding of approximately 74.8 million.

RealPage management expects to achieve the following results during its calendar year ended December 31, 2012:

  • Non-GAAP total revenue is expected to be in the range of $322.0 million to $324.0 million;
  • Adjusted EBITDA is expected to be in the range of $72.5 million to $74.0 million;
  • Non-GAAP net income is expected to be in the range of $34.4 million to $35.2 million, or $0.47 to $0.48 per diluted share;
  • Non-GAAP tax rate of approximately 40.0%; and
  • Full year weighted average shares outstanding of approximately 73.9 million.

Please note that the above statements are forward looking and that Non-GAAP total revenue includes an adjustment for the effect of deferred revenue from acquired companies that is required to be written down for GAAP purposes under purchase accounting rules. In addition, the above statements also include the impact of acquisitions and exclude any costs resulting from the Yardi litigation (including settlement costs and related insurance litigation). Actual results may differ materially. Please reference the information under the caption "Non-GAAP Financial Measures" as part of this press release.

About RealPage

Located in Carrollton, Texas, a suburb of Dallas, RealPage provides on demand (also referred to as "Software-as-a-Service" or "SaaS") products and services to apartment communities and single family rentals across the United States. Its on demand product lines include OneSite® property management systems that automate the leasing, renting, management, and accounting of conventional, affordable, tax credit, student living, senior living and military housing properties; LeaseStar™ multichannel managed marketing that enables owners to originate, syndicate, manage and capture leads more effectively and at less overall cost; YieldStar® asset optimization systems that enable owners and managers to optimize rents to achieve the overall highest yield, or combination of rent and occupancy, at each property; Velocity™ billing and utility management services that increase collections and reduce delinquencies; LeasingDesk® risk mitigation systems that are designed to reduce a community's exposure to risk and liability; OpsTechnology® spend management systems that help owners manage and control operating expenses; and Compliance Depot™ vendor management and qualification services to assist a community in managing its compliance vendor program. Supporting this family of SaaS products is a suite of shared cloud services including electronic payments, document management, decision support and learning. Through its Propertyware subsidiary, RealPage also provides software and services to single-family rentals and low density, centrally-managed multifamily housing. Non-GAAP Financial Measures

This press release contains non-GAAP financial measures. These measures differ from GAAP in that they exclude amortization of intangible assets, stock-based compensation expenses, any impact related to the Yardi litigation (including settlement costs and related insurance litigation), acquisition-related deferred revenue adjustments, and acquisition related expenses (including any purchase accounting adjustments). Reconciliation tables comparing GAAP financial measures to non-GAAP financial measures are included at the end of this release.

We define Adjusted EBITDA as net (loss) income plus acquisition-related deferred revenue adjustment, depreciation and asset impairment, amortization of intangible assets, net interest expense, income tax expense (benefit), stock-based compensation expense, any impact related to Yardi litigation (including settlement costs and related insurance litigation), and acquisition-related expense.

We believe that the use of Adjusted EBITDA is useful to investors and other users of our financial statements in evaluating our operating performance because it provides them with an additional tool to compare business performance across companies and across periods. We believe that:

  • Adjusted EBITDA provides investors and other users of our financial information consistency and comparability with our past financial performance, facilitates period-to-period comparisons of operations and facilitates comparisons with our peer companies, many of which use similar non-GAAP financial measures to supplement their GAAP results; and
  • it is useful to exclude certain non-cash charges, such as depreciation and asset impairment, amortization of intangible assets and stock-based compensation and non-core operational charges, such as acquisition-related expense and any impact related to the Yardi litigation (including settlement costs and related insurance litigation), from Adjusted EBITDA because the amount of such expenses in any specific period may not directly correlate to the underlying performance of our business operations and these expenses can vary significantly between periods as a result of new acquisitions, full amortization of previously acquired tangible and intangible assets or the timing of new stock-based awards, as the case may be.

We use Adjusted EBITDA in conjunction with traditional GAAP operating performance measures as part of our overall assessment of our performance, for planning purposes, including the preparation of our annual operating budget, to evaluate the effectiveness of our business strategies and to communicate with our board of directors concerning our financial performance.

We do not place undue reliance on Adjusted EBITDA as our only measure of operating performance. Adjusted EBITDA should not be considered as a substitute for other measures of liquidity or financial performance reported in accordance with GAAP. There are limitations to using non-GAAP financial measures, including that other companies may calculate these measures differently than we do, that they do not reflect our capital expenditures or future requirements for capital expenditures and that they do not reflect changes in, or cash requirements for, our working capital. We compensate for the inherent limitations associated with using Adjusted EBITDA measures through disclosure of these limitations, presentation of our financial statements in accordance with GAAP and reconciliation of Adjusted EBITDA to the most directly comparable GAAP measure, net (loss) income.
